    A talent agent, or booking agent, is a person who finds work for actors, authors, broadcast journalists, film directors, musicians, models, professional athletes, screenwriters, writers, and other professionals in various entertainment or sports businesses. In addition, an agent defends, supports and promotes the interest of their clients.

    Creative Artists Agency LLC ( CAA) is an American talent and sports agency based in Los Angeles, California. With 1,800 employees in March 2016, [ 1] it is regarded as an influential company in the talent agency business and manages numerous clients.     United Talent Agency (UTA) is a global talent agency based in Beverly Hills, California. Established in 1991, it represents artists and other professionals across the entertainment industry.
